What you'll learn

  • Evaluate new neuroscience information to understand and treat ADHD, Aggression, Autism Spectrum Disorder, fatigue, and stress

  • Assess the latest medications and combinations for ADHD, aggression and social disorders

  • Utilize knowledge of the effects of a good sleep program as a necessary component of a health promoting lifestyle for caregivers and their patients

  • Judge the efficacy of diet changes, the need for gluten–free diets, and the use of probiotics

  • See the course registration page for additional learning objectives

Course description

This is accredited, livestreamed course offered by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center is part of the 32nd Annual Summer Seminar series.
